Typical Solar Geyser faults
Lenasia Central is known to have the following parts failure on Solar Geysers:
Booster Element and Thermostat
Faulty booster elements and thermostats are replaced by our team in Lenasia Central almost daily. We do this by disconnecting the geyser from water and electricity. Once the geyser is disconnected we can then drain it and do the replacement. Upon completion, we can reassemble the geyser and fill it with water after we have reconnected the geyser. Now, we will be able to test the geyser.
Geyserwise System
When you notice that your display is dead, it is advised that you contact us so that we can test your unit. Once the unit has been confirmed as dead, we just simply replace it.
Circulation Pump
When your geyser becomes faulty by not producing any hot water, it could be the circulation pump that has become faulty. This is one of the first suspects in our investigation. If we have confirmed that it is indeed your circulation pump, we will simply swap it out with a new one.
Can I repair a geyser myself, or should I call a professional?
While minor checks like inspecting for external leaks are manageable, complex geyser repairs demand professional attention. Trained technicians ensure safety and efficiency, addressing issues like faulty thermostats or pressure valves comprehensively.

What are the common signs that my geyser needs repairs?
Unusual behavior from your geyser, such as a tripping circuit breaker, fluctuating water pressure, or water thats too hot or cold, is a clear sign that repairs are needed to maintain efficiency.
Why is my geyser not heating water properly?
Water temperature problems in geysers are often due to aging components. Older systems lose efficiency, and upgrading or replacing parts like the heating element can solve the issue.
What causes water to leak from a geyser?
Sediment buildup in the geyser tank can contribute to leaks. Deposits trap moisture against the tank walls, promoting corrosion and eventually causing cracks or perforations that lead to water leakage.
Why is my geyser making unusual noises like popping or banging?
Banging noises in a geyser may occur due to excessive pressure buildup. Faulty pressure valves or overheating can cause water to boil and release steam abruptly, creating these alarming sounds.
What should I do if my geyser trips the electricity?
Geyser-related electrical trips can indicate serious issues like damaged wiring or component failures. Shut off the power immediately and consult a professional to diagnose and resolve the problem efficiently.
Why is the water pressure from my geyser too low?
A common cause of low water pressure in geysers is a leak in the pipes. Inspect for visible leaks and fix them promptly to restore proper pressure and prevent further water loss.
How do I know if the thermostat in my geyser is faulty?
Testing the thermostats functionality with a multimeter can confirm faults. If the device shows no continuity or incorrect readings, the thermostat is defective and must be replaced promptly.
What happens if the geyser’s heating element is damaged?
If your geysers heating element is damaged, you might experience fluctuating water temperatures. This inconsistency affects comfort and can signal further issues within the system if not addressed promptly.

What causes the geyser’s tank to corrode?
Corrosion in geyser tanks is exacerbated by fluctuations in water pressure. High pressure stresses the tank walls, creating microcracks where rust can begin to form over time.
How often should I service my geyser to avoid repairs?
Servicing your geyser every year is crucial to prevent repairs. Professional maintenance addresses common issues like mineral deposits and aging components, ensuring the unit operates efficiently and without interruptions.
Can sediment buildup in a geyser be prevented?
Preventing sediment buildup in a geyser involves periodic flushing. This simple process removes mineral deposits and keeps the heating element running efficiently, reducing energy consumption and potential damage to the tank.
